Why Separate Classes Rarely Share What Matters
Each intake arrives with fresh energy and fresh blind spots. Mentors repeat the same market sizing advice, legal checklists, and hiring cautions because the previous class left no living record that later teams can query. Over time the cost of that repetition shows up as slower go to market cycles and higher founder burnout. A cross cohort knowledge base changes the default from private notebooks to shared, versioned records that survive the end of any single program cycle. When the base is designed well, a new batch can locate prior experiments on pricing, channel tests, and regulatory filings within minutes rather than weeks.
The difference is architectural, not cultural. Culture alone cannot force people to file notes they believe no one will read. Architecture can make filing the path of least resistance by embedding capture into existing rituals such as demo day debriefs and investor update drafts. Core Layers of a Cross Cohort Store
Four layers keep the system usable as volume grows. The first layer holds raw artifacts: pitch decks, customer interview transcripts, term sheet redlines, and experiment logs. The second layer holds structured summaries that tag each artifact by industry, stage, geography, and outcome. The third layer holds decision trees that encode what worked under which conditions. The fourth layer holds access rules that protect founder confidentiality while still letting analysts and reporters extract aggregates.
Without the summary and decision layers, search returns noise. Without access rules, trust collapses and founders stop contributing. The architecture must therefore treat privacy as a first class concern equal to search speed. Teams that skip this balance often end up with two parallel systems: an official repository that is empty and a private chat history that is rich but invisible to later cohorts.
Benchmarks Analysts Can Apply Immediately
Analysts need numbers that travel across programs of different sizes. Four measures have proven durable. First, the reuse rate: the percentage of new cohort projects that cite at least one prior cohort artifact within the first thirty days. A healthy range sits above forty percent after the second year of operation. Second, the time to first useful hit: the median minutes from a new founder query to a document that changes their plan. Under ten minutes indicates strong tagging. Third, the contradiction density: the number of opposing recommendations that remain unresolved in the same topic cluster. High density signals missing decision trees. Fourth, the external validation ratio: the share of internal claims that have been checked against public filings or peer reviewed sources.
These benchmarks can be computed with simple logging. They do not require machine learning. They do require consistent taxonomy so that “pricing experiment” means the same thing in every batch. Analysts covering the space can request the four numbers as part of any program review and compare them across years. What Reporters Should Demand Before Publishing Claims
Reporters face a different risk: overstating the novelty of an incubator’s knowledge claims. A program may announce a new framework while quietly recycling content that already existed three cohorts earlier. To test originality, reporters can ask for the version history of the core playbooks and for the percentage of pages that have received material updates in the last twelve months. They can also request a sample of redacted case studies that show how a later cohort altered an earlier recommendation after new evidence arrived.
Access to patent and trademark trends supplies an external check. If an incubator claims deep expertise in deep tech commercialization, the volume and quality of related filings can be examined at the US Patent and Trademark Office. Similarly, capital raising narratives can be stress tested against public company disclosures available from the US Securities and Exchange Commission. When internal knowledge bases lack these external anchors, reporters should treat success stories as provisional.

Measuring Transfer Without Heavy Process
Transfer measurement can stay light. At the close of each cohort, facilitators ask three questions: which prior artifact changed a decision, which gap forced reinvention, and which new artifact should become standard. Answers feed the summary layer. Six months later a short survey checks whether the new standards were actually used. The resulting transfer score is simply the fraction of recommended artifacts that later cohorts report as helpful. Scores below twenty five percent trigger a review of tagging and discoverability rather than a new content campaign.

Infrastructure That Ages Gracefully
Technology choices matter less than ownership and migration paths. Prefer formats that remain readable without proprietary software. Prefer open metadata standards so that a future platform can import history without loss. Prefer clear data controllers so that founders know who can delete or export their material after they leave. When programs scale from dozens to hundreds of companies, these choices prevent the base from becoming a brittle museum.

Putting the Architecture to Work for Coverage and Evaluation
Analysts and reporters gain most when they treat the knowledge base as a living instrument rather than a static library. They can publish scorecards that track the four benchmarks over time, highlight contradictions that remain unresolved, and note when external validation lags. Programs that improve year over year earn credibility; those that plateau invite harder questions about whether claimed learning is actually compounding.
Founders themselves benefit when the same architecture is transparent. They can see which of their experiments will be preserved for later teams and which access rules protect sensitive customer data. That transparency raises contribution quality because people understand the lasting value of careful notes. The practical test is simple. Open the store as a new founder would. Can you locate a prior pricing test in under ten minutes? Can you see how a later cohort revised the original advice? Can you verify at least one claim against a public authority? Affirmative answers indicate an architecture worth covering and worth joining. Negative answers indicate that the program is still running on tribal memory, no matter how polished its public materials appear.
